I have 3 Tunze powerheads with Voltages of 2-10V. The actual min to spin the impellor and max are specific to the pump models.

They are assigned to the same stream group.
Mode: Sequence 1
Duration 03:37:00 - 04:33:00 for a 4 hourish flow before moving to the next pump.

Waves: Sinus
Duration 30.4 - 60 s
Randomwave reduction 10s

Nocturnal enabled from 00:10 till 06:20.

From there you have to assign pumps. The pump numbers will coincide with the 1-10V interface settings. For me I have:
Pump 1 40% min 100% max 30% nocturnal
Pump 2 40% min 100% max 30% nocturnal (split to control a pair of Tunze pumps via cable.)

Results:
Pump 1 is continuous flow while Pump 2 is creating waves. After ~4 hours. Pump 2 is continuous flow and Pump 1 is creating waves.
